Unidirectional photoinduced shuttling in a rotaxane with a symmetric stilbene dumbbell
Up and down the dumbbell: Photoisomerization of a stilbene rotaxane results in relocation of the cyclodextrin macrocycle in just one direction (see scheme). This behavior, and that of related rotaxanes, sheds light on the mechanism of shuttling in molecular machines.
